Eventbrite is a leading event technology platform that provides comprehensive tools for creating, managing, and promoting events. Serving a diverse range of clients from small community organizers to large-scale event professionals, Eventbrite operates in the global event management market. The platform enables users to set up professional event listings, customize ticketing options, and utilize real-time insights to optimize event performance. Eventbrite's business model is primarily based on a freemium approach, offering basic services for free while charging for premium features and services. Revenue is generated through service fees on ticket sales, premium subscriptions, and tailored partnerships for complex events. The platform supports event marketing through integrations with social media channels like Facebook and Instagram, allowing organizers to reach a broader audience. Eventbrite's mission is to empower event creators with the freedom and flexibility to deliver meaningful experiences without limitations.
